Output 66bb7fc3a05c4f1effca3452f9d0623e69d570968cb033842e17cc14ca70fe0a:0

value
10378019
script pubkey
OP_0 OP_PUSHBYTES_20 a762fe65e02cea72adc2c9efdcf3ccaf6051e793
address
ltc1q5a30ue0q9n489twze8haeu7v4as9reunk4pj9t
transaction
66bb7fc3a05c4f1effca3452f9d0623e69d570968cb033842e17cc14ca70fe0a
spent
true